[Solved] Ran fdupes -rd /home without -A, now flatpak is dead, any help?

Anyone has any ideas how to revive it? Whenever I try to run anything, I get

bwrap: Unable to open lock file /usr/.ref: No such file or directory
error: ldconfig failed, exit status 256

No logs in syslog other than an attempted launch.

Google is surprisingly unhelpful on this one. I've tried both flatpak repair and apt install --reinstall flatpak to no success. AI suggests to straight up purge flatpak entirely and start anew, but I am wary of it also taking out the app caches, logins, configs, etc, which I'd rather preserve if possible.

Distro is pop 22, btw
